前言:在使用免费LoRaWAN服务器www.thethingsnetwork.org一文中我们主要说明了如何在thethingsnetwork.org上面注册网关、创建应用、创建设备等,thethingsnetwork.org(下称TTN)只是一个网络服务器(network server),不会保存应用数据,因此实际项目中还需要一个应用服务器(application server),thethin
Mqtt Paho(Java)的及使用此篇呢就说浅浅的说下Mqtt Paho的及使用.还是一样,咋们先看下配置项MqttConnectionOption里的配置里有setAutomaticReconnect这个选项它需要放入一个布尔值(Boolean)来控制开关1.True 设定为true时,mqtt的机制会启动,当mqtt client掉线之后它会进入.2.False 设定为fa
转载 2024-04-09 18:06:36
524阅读
# 如何实现“java MQTTClient 无法” ## 简介 作为一名经验丰富的开发者,我将向你展示如何实现“java MQTTClient 无法”。在这篇文章中,我将指导你完成整个流程,并提供每一个步骤所需的代码示例以及注释说明。 ## 流程步骤 | 步骤 | 描述 | | --- | --- | | 1 | 创建 MQTTClient 实例 | | 2 | 设置 MQTT
原创 2024-03-28 07:33:55
189阅读
下面体朋几一级发等点确层数框的很屏果行4带域将给出基于Promise式的写法。并且实现动直分调浏器代,刚求的一学础过功互有解小久宗点差维含数如数围请态的队列绑定初始化配置const amqp = require('amqplib') // rabbitMQ地址 const {amqpAddrHost} = require('../config/index.js') // 交换机名称 const e
转载 2024-06-27 08:43:05
150阅读
概述TCP是面向连接的通信协议,通过三次握手建立连接,然后开始数据读写,通信完成后断开连接。因为是面向连接的,所以只能适合端对端的通信。TCP提供的是可靠的数据流服务,当数据流大的时候,数据会被拆分发送,所以超时重传机制和应答确认机制就至关重要。超时重传的时长是根据网络情况动态调整的,抽样统计一个数据包由发送到接收再到回复的时长,这个时间为RTT,也就往返时延,最后通过各种算法和公式平滑RTT确定
Rabbit MQ作为主流的消息中间件,今天来上手使用一下。Rabbit MQ 常用模式 : 一对一直连 、一对多工作模式、发布订阅模式、路由模式、主题Topic模式 springBoot 集成rabbitMq1、加入依赖<!--rabbitmq--> <dependency> <groupId>org.spri
# Java MQTT断开 ## 介绍 M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息传输协议,广泛应用于物联网和机器到机器(M2M)通信中。在使用MQTT时,客户端与服务器之间可能会发生断开连接的情况,因此需要实现断开的机制。本文将介绍在Java中如何实现MQTT的断开,并提供代码示例。 ## MQTT断开机制 MQT
原创 2023-10-27 09:00:45
566阅读
# Java Socket断开 在使用Java进行网络通信时,Socket是一个常见的工具。Socket可以用于建立客户端和服务器端之间的通信连接。然而,在实际使用中,Socket连接有可能会断开,这时我们需要进行断开的操作。本文将介绍如何在Java中实现Socket断开,并提供相应的代码示例。 ## Socket断开的原因 Socket断开的原因可能有很多,例如网络状况不稳
原创 2023-08-19 04:59:32
1124阅读
# Java TCP Client的断开机制 在分布式系统和网络编程中,网络的不稳定性使得客户端和服务器之间的连接常常会出现中断。因此,实现一个能够自动的TCP客户端对于提升应用的可用性和用户体验是至关重要的。本文将探讨如何在Java中实现TCP客户端的断开,并提供相关的代码示例。 ## 什么是TCP连接? TCP(传输控制协议)是一种面向连接的协议,它确保了数据的可靠传输。当T
原创 2024-08-22 03:39:12
458阅读
# 实现Java gRPC断开 ## 简介 在使用gRPC进行网络通信时,由于网络不稳定或服务端重启等原因,可能会导致与服务端的连接断开。为了保持与服务端的稳定连接,需要实现断开机制。本文将向你展示如何在Java中实现gRPC的断开功能。 ## 流程概述 下面的表格展示了整个断开的流程。 | 步骤 | 描述 | | --- | --- | | 1 | 创建gRPC Chann
原创 2023-12-23 07:06:46
901阅读
文章目录架构生产者(Producer)消费者(Consumer)Name Server功能:路由注册:无状态方式的优缺点:路由剔除:路由发现:客户端NameServer选择策略Broker功能模块图集群部署工作流程流程:Topic的创建模式读/写队列 架构RocketMQ主要分为四部分组成:生产者(Producer)消息生产者,负责生产消息。Producer通过MQ的负载均衡模块选择相应的Bro
前言 最近学习了Netty后,总想让Netty发挥点作用。于是自己用了两个场景,一个是web聊天室,一个是Netty同步缓存数据。这篇文章对使用Netty的核心关键点做一次总结;websocket实现核心就是在pipeline中加入netty提供的WebSocketServerProtocolHandler和Http解码器HttpServerCodec// websocket协议本身是基
转载 2024-06-24 05:52:54
83阅读
# 实现Java ServerSocket断开 ## 一、整体流程 ```mermaid journey title Java ServerSocket断开实现流程 section 连接建立 Java ServerSocket创建 Java Socket客户端连接 section 连接断开 检测到连接断开
原创 2024-06-17 03:46:26
91阅读
# 如何实现 Java Zookeeper 断开 ## 1. 流程表格 | 步骤 | 描述 | | ---- | ---- | | 1 | 创建 Zookeeper 连接 | | 2 | 监听连接状态 | | 3 | 断开连接 | | 4 | | ## 2. 具体步骤及代码说明 ### 步骤一:创建 Zookeeper 连接 ```java // 创建 Zookeeper 连接
原创 2024-03-15 03:13:39
123阅读
如果只是为了开发 Kafka 应用程序,或者只是在生产环境使用 Kafka,那么了解 Kafka 的内部工作原理不是必须的。不过,了解 Kafka 的内部工作原理有助于理解 Kafka 的行为,也利用快速诊断问题。下面我们来探讨一下这三个问题Kafka 是如何进行复制的Kafka 是如何处理来自生产者和消费者的请求的Kafka 的存储细节是怎样的如果感兴趣的话,就请花费你一些时间,耐心看
# MQTT 断开Java 实现指南 MQTT(消息队列遥测传输)是一种轻量级的消息发布/订阅协议,它被广泛应用于物联网(IoT)场景。然而,在实际使用中,连接可能会因为各种原因断开,因而需要实现断开机制。这篇文章将指导你如何在 Java 中实现 MQTT 的断开,并通过代码示例详细说明每个步骤。我们将使用 Eclipse Paho MQTT 客户端库作为示例。 ## 整体流程
原创 2024-10-16 04:25:18
101阅读
四、MQTT的基本概念1.MQTT的主题和主题过滤器在MQTT当中,消息是没有消息队列这一概念,那它是怎么隔离区分各种繁杂的消息呢,这里就涉及到 主题 概念,不同的主题可被不同的订阅者订阅,发布者可以发布不同的主题消息,从而将消息进行一个隔离区分。MQTT 协议规定主题是 UTF-8 编码的字符串。命名规则:所有的主题名必须至少包含一个字符主题名是大小写敏感的。主题名可以包含空格字符。主题名以前置
转载 2024-10-18 08:55:04
83阅读
在通过 MqttClient 客户端连接之后,在服务端服务重启时,客户端如果没有机制,则无法再接收到订阅的消息。使用的 Mqtt 组件为:M2Mqtt.Net.dll一些特性发现(1)如果提供的服务端地址是不可解析的,会引发异常无法实例化 MqttClient 对象。 (2)Connect 无法连接时会引发异常,IsConnected 为 false。 (3)服务端断开会触发客户端的 Conn
转载 2023-06-26 13:59:48
1474阅读
这是机器未来的第33篇文章1. 概述本文描述了MQTT3.1.1协议链路保活及断开的消息逻辑。2. PINGREQ – PING 请求PINGREQ 数据包从客户端发送到服务器。它可用于:在没有任何其他控制数据包从客户端发送到服务器的情况下,向服务器指示客户端是活动的。请求服务器响应以确认它是活动的。运行网络以指示网络连接处于活动状态。此数据包用于 Keep Alive保活处理,与其CONNECT
# Java MQTT 断开的实现 M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息协议,广泛用于物联网(IoT)应用中。由于网络的不稳定性,MQTT连接经常会出现断开的情况。在这篇文章中,我们将讨论如何在Java中实现MQTT的断开功能,并提供相关代码示例。 ## 什么是MQTT? MQTT协议是一种基于发布/订阅模型的协议,
原创 2024-09-29 04:29:56
41阅读
  • 1
  • 2
  • 3
  • 4
  • 5